*{-webkit-box-sizing:border-box;box-sizing:border-box;margin:0;padding:0}@font-face{font-display:swap;font-family:Montserrat;font-style:normal;font-weight:400;src:url(/wp-content/themes/dgp-theme/assets/fonts/montserrat-v31-latin-regular.woff2) format("woff2")}@font-face{font-display:swap;font-family:Montserrat;font-style:normal;font-weight:600;src:url(/wp-content/themes/dgp-theme/assets/fonts/montserrat-v31-latin-600.woff2) format("woff2")}:root{--cp-text-primary:#000000;--cp-bg-primary:#f5f5f5;--cp-1-light:#9c395f;--cp-1:#6a0035;--cp-1-dark:#601534;--font-primary:"Montserrat",sans-serif;--rgba-dark-1:rgba(0, 0, 0, 0.1);--rgba-dark-2:rgba(0, 0, 0, 0.2);--rgba-dark-3:rgba(0, 0, 0, 0.3);--rgba-light-1:rgba(255, 255, 255, 0.1);--rgba-light-2:rgba(255, 255, 255, 0.2);--rgba-light-3:rgba(255, 255, 255, 0.3)}body{font-family:var(--font-primary);color:var(--cp-text-primary);background-color:var(--cp-bg-primary);font-size:14px;line-height:1.5;font-weight:400}@media (min-width:640px){body{font-size:15px}}.section{width:100%}.section.normal{padding-top:1rem;padding-bottom:1rem}.section .inner-section{width:100%;padding:0 1rem}.section .inner-section .container{width:100%;margin:0 auto}@media (min-width:840px){.section .inner-section .container{max-width:640px}}.flex-col{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.flex-row{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row}.align-center{-webkit-box-align:center;-ms-flex-align:center;align-items:center}.justify-center{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.flex-wrap{-ms-flex-wrap:wrap;flex-wrap:wrap}.flex-no-wrap{-ms-flex-wrap:nowrap;flex-wrap:nowrap}.no-grow{-webkit-box-flex:0;-ms-flex-positive:0;flex-grow:0}.grow{-webkit-box-flex:1;-ms-flex-positive:1;flex-grow:1}.no-shrink{-ms-flex-negative:0;flex-shrink:0}.shrink{-ms-flex-negative:1;flex-shrink:1}.gap-0{gap:0}.gap-0-5{gap:.5rem}.gap-1{gap:1rem}.gap-1-5{gap:1.5rem}.gap-2{gap:2rem}.gap-2-5{gap:2.5rem}.gap-3{gap:3rem}.w100{width:100%}.h100{height:100%}h1,h2,h3,h4,h5,h6{font-weight:600;margin-bottom:.5rem}h1{font-size:1.3rem}h2{font-size:1.2rem}h3{font-size:1.1rem}h4{font-size:1rem}h5{font-size:.9rem}h6{font-size:.8rem}.fs-12{font-size:12px}.fs-13{font-size:13px}.fs-14{font-size:14px}.fs-15{font-size:15px}p{margin-bottom:1rem;line-height:1.6}p:has(img) img{max-width:100%;border-radius:7px;display:block}figure{width:100%!important;margin-bottom:1rem}figure figcaption{font-size:.9rem;color:var(--cp-text-primary);text-align:center;margin-top:.5rem}figure img{width:100%;height:auto;display:block;border-radius:7px}.fw-600{font-weight:600}ol,ul{margin-bottom:1rem;padding-left:1.5rem;line-height:1.6}a{color:inherit;text-decoration:none}.color-cp-1-dark{color:var(--cp-1-dark)}.underline{text-decoration:underline}.btn.btn-medium{padding:.5rem 1rem;border-radius:7px}.btn.btn-whatsapp{background:-webkit-gradient(linear,left top,right top,from(green),color-stop(darkgreen),to(green));background:linear-gradient(to right,green,#006400,green);color:#fff;display:block;width:-webkit-max-content;width:-moz-max-content;width:max-content}.btn.btn-call{background:-webkit-gradient(linear,left top,right top,from(orangered),color-stop(orange),to(orangered));background:linear-gradient(to right,#ff4500,orange,#ff4500);color:#fff;display:block;width:-webkit-max-content;width:-moz-max-content;width:max-content}.lns{list-style:none;padding:0;margin:0;-webkit-margin-before:0;margin-block-start:0;-webkit-margin-after:0;margin-block-end:0;-webkit-padding-start:0;padding-inline-start:0}#part-footer{background-color:var(--cp-text-primary);color:var(--cp-bg-primary)}#part-footer .inner-section .container{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center}#part-footer .inner-section .container nav ul{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;gap:1rem}#part-footer .inner-section .container nav ul li{position:relative}#part-footer .inner-section .container nav ul li:before{content:"#"}#part-footer .inner-section .container nav ul li:hover{border-bottom:1px solid var(--cp-1-light)}#part-footer .inner-section .container nav ul li:hover a{color:var(--cp-1-light)}#part-footer .inner-section .container nav ul li:hover:before{color:var(--cp-1-light)}#part-header{background-color:var(--cp-1-dark);color:var(--cp-bg-primary);height:80px}#part-header .inner-section .container{display:grid;grid-template-columns:1fr auto;-webkit-box-align:center;-ms-flex-align:center;align-items:center}#part-header .inner-section .container .left{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}#part-header .inner-section .container .left h2{font-size:1rem}#part-header .inner-section .container .left h2 a{text-decoration:none;text-transform:uppercase}#part-header .inner-section .container .right{overflow:hidden;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}@media (min-width:768px){#part-header .inner-section .container .right{width:auto;-webkit-box-flex:1;-ms-flex-positive:1;flex-grow:1;-webkit-box-align:end;-ms-flex-align:end;align-items:flex-end}}#part-header .inner-section .container .right nav{width:calc(100% - 5rem);height:100vh;position:fixed;top:0;left:0;background:-webkit-gradient(linear,left top,left bottom,from(var(--cp-1-dark)),to(var(--cp-1)));background:linear-gradient(to bottom,var(--cp-1-dark),var(--cp-1));display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-transform:translateX(-100%);transform:translateX(-100%);-webkit-transition:-webkit-transform .3s ease-in-out;transition:-webkit-transform .3s ease-in-out;transition:transform .3s ease-in-out;transition:transform .3s ease-in-out,-webkit-transform .3s ease-in-out}@media (min-width:768px){#part-header .inner-section .container .right nav{width:auto;position:static;height:auto;background-color:transparent;-webkit-transform:translateX(0);transform:translateX(0)}}#part-header .inner-section .container .right nav.active{-webkit-transform:translateX(0);transform:translateX(0)}#part-header .inner-section .container .right nav ul{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:1rem;font-size:1rem;font-weight:600}@media (min-width:768px){#part-header .inner-section .container .right nav ul{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row}}#part-header .inner-section .container .right nav ul li{text-align:center}#part-header .inner-section .container .right nav ul li a{text-decoration:none;color:var(--cp-bg-primary)}#part-header .inner-section .container .right .bars{display:block;width:23px;height:20px;position:relative;cursor:pointer}@media (min-width:768px){#part-header .inner-section .container .right .bars{display:none}}#part-header .inner-section .container .right .bars .bar{background-color:var(--cp-bg-primary);height:3px;width:100%;position:absolute;left:0;border-radius:2px;-webkit-transition:all .3s linear;transition:all .3s linear}#part-header .inner-section .container .right .bars .bar:nth-child(1){top:0}#part-header .inner-section .container .right .bars .bar:nth-child(1).active{-webkit-transform:rotate(45deg) translateY(-50%);transform:rotate(45deg) translateY(-50%);top:50%}#part-header .inner-section .container .right .bars .bar:nth-child(2){top:50%;-webkit-transform:translateY(-50%);transform:translateY(-50%)}#part-header .inner-section .container .right .bars .bar:nth-child(2).active{opacity:0}#part-header .inner-section .container .right .bars .bar:nth-child(3){bottom:0}#part-header .inner-section .container .right .bars .bar:nth-child(3).active{-webkit-transform:rotate(-45deg) translateY(50%);transform:rotate(-45deg) translateY(50%);bottom:50%}#part-headline .inner-section .container .headline-wrapper{width:100%;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;overflow:hidden;gap:.5rem}#part-headline .inner-section .container .headline-wrapper .headline{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-flex:1;-ms-flex:1 1 calc(50% - .5rem);flex:1 1 calc(50% - .5rem)}#part-headline .inner-section .container .headline-wrapper .headline .top{width:100%;aspect-ratio:16/9;overflow:hidden}#part-headline .inner-section .container .headline-wrapper .headline .top a{display:block;width:100%;height:100%}#part-headline .inner-section .container .headline-wrapper .headline .top a img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;display:block;border-radius:7px}#part-headline .inner-section .container .headline-wrapper .headline .bot{padding:.5rem;width:100%}#part-headline .inner-section .container .headline-wrapper .headline:first-child{-webkit-box-flex:1;-ms-flex:1 1 100%;flex:1 1 100%}#part-headline .inner-section .container .headline-wrapper .headline:nth-child(n+4){-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-webkit-box-flex:0;-ms-flex:0 0 100%;flex:0 0 100%;border-bottom:1px dashed var(--rgba-dark-1)}#part-headline .inner-section .container .headline-wrapper .headline:nth-child(n+4) .top{width:80px;aspect-ratio:1/1}#part-headline .inner-section .container .headline-wrapper .headline:nth-child(n+4) .top a{display:block}#part-headline .inner-section .container .headline-wrapper .headline:nth-child(n+4) .top a img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}#part-headline .inner-section .container .headline-wrapper .headline:nth-child(n+4) .bot h3{over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;line-clamp:3;line-height:1.4em;max-height:4.2em}#part-headline .inner-section .container .pagination-wrapper{margin-top:1rem;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:1.5rem}#single-diklat .inner-section .container .top h1{border-bottom:1px dashed var(--rgba-dark-1);padding-bottom:1rem;margin-bottom:0}#single-diklat .inner-section .container .top .post-thumbnail{width:100%}#single-diklat .inner-section .container .top .post-thumbnail img{width:100%;height:auto}#the-content p a img{max-width:100%;height:auto;display:block}#the-content p:has(img){display:block;padding:0;margin:1rem 0 1rem 0;max-width:100%}#the-content p:has(img) img{max-width:100%;height:auto;display:block}#the-content iframe{width:100%;aspect-ratio:16/9;border-radius:10px}#the-content video{width:100%;border-radius:10px;margin-bottom:1rem;border-radius:10px}#the-content .referensi{background-color:var(--cp-1-dark);color:var(--cp-bg-primary);padding:2rem 1rem;border-radius:10px;-webkit-box-shadow:0 2px 5px rgba(0,0,0,.1);box-shadow:0 2px 5px rgba(0,0,0,.1);display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:.5rem;-webkit-box-align:center;-ms-flex-align:center;align-items:center;margin-bottom:1rem}#the-content .referensi .logo{width:80px;height:80px;border-radius:50%;overflow:hidden}#the-content .referensi .logo img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;display:block}#the-content .referensi .informasi{text-align:center}#the-content .referensi .meta ul{list-style:square;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:.25rem}#the-content .referensi .cta{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;gap:.5rem}#the-content li{margin-bottom:8px}